diff --git a/include/flatbuffers/flatbuffers.h b/include/flatbuffers/flatbuffers.h index 07b7cadec..e94d0de70 100644 --- a/include/flatbuffers/flatbuffers.h +++ b/include/flatbuffers/flatbuffers.h @@ -1153,13 +1153,13 @@ template const T *GetRoot(const void *buf) { /// Helpers to get a typed pointer to objects that are currently beeing built. /// @warning Creating new objects will lead to reallocations and invalidates the pointer! -template T *GetMutableObject(FlatBufferBuilder &fbb, Offset offset) { +template T *GetMutableTemporaryPointer(FlatBufferBuilder &fbb, Offset offset) { return reinterpret_cast(fbb.GetCurrentBufferPointer() + fbb.GetSize() - offset.o); } -template const T *GetObject(FlatBufferBuilder &fbb, Offset offset) { - return GetMutableObject(fbb, offset); +template const T *GetTemporaryPointer(FlatBufferBuilder &fbb, Offset offset) { + return GetMutableTemporaryPointer(fbb, offset); } // Helper to see if the identifier in a buffer has the expected value.